In ancient times, this region encompassed most of present-day Aydın and Muğla provinces, as well as the western edge of Denizli province. The northern boundary is defined by the Büyük Menderes (Maiandros) River, while the Indos River forms the border with Lycia to the east. The Aegean Sea borders the west and south.
The stones used in this product come from natural environments, specifically the KAIKOS River, which originates from Ömer Mountain south of Balıkesir. As it flows south past Bakır Village near Kırkağaç, it is known today as Bakırcay. It flows through the Madra and Yunt Mountains and empties into the İzmir Çandarlı Bay, passing by the ancient city of Pergamon (Bergama) at the confluence of the Kaikos and Selinus Rivers. The mountains surrounding the Kaikos Valley contain abundant granite deposits.
